Alive and Well - Quiet Riot

Quiet Riot is back with their 7th North American release, Alive and Well.  Alive and Well is a return for the Quiet Riot guys to their hard rock roots.  As an added bonus this CD includes six remixes of old favorites and hits from their most famous albums.

Alive and Well is not my favorite Quiet Riot album, nor is it at the bottom of the list.  As a big fan of the band this album is a refreshing return to the music that I grew up to.  It is hard with fast paced songs and lyrics that speak (in this case) to the working man, real, normal, "adult" people.  The band has grown up along with their music and now write for a similar audience.  Quiet Riot has joined us in the nineties and I for one will be looking forward to them in the next century.

The remixes have the same grown up feel as the rest of the album and take some different paths than the original.  As special note, the remix of "Don't Wanna Let You Go" is excellent and presents the song as an acoustic version.  Also, their biggest hit "Wild and the Young" has a great new sound.
